      Like most of science it came step-wise. First scientists discovered electron beams in gas discharge tubes and then realized that the electrons came from atoms/ molecules which had developed a positive charge. JJ Thomson devised the mass spectroscope to study these charged atoms/ molecules and found they had different trajectories through electric or magnetic fields - discriminated by their mass/ charge ratio. This was 100 years ago and gave the first evidence for isotopes (20-Ne and 22-Ne). Over a century technology has improved but the principles are the same - ions separated by their mass.
